Take one uber sexy AP racing caliper from an MGF Trophy
.jpg)
Mix in one angle grinder, gentle applied
.jpg)
Remove fat
.jpg)
Mill surface and drill and tap two M12 Hydracoils

Turn two solid Aluminum billets into two identical alloys bells, Powder coat black
.jpg)
Buy 16V mk2 golf hub from scrappy - same as on MK2 ibiza to check alignement
.jpg)
Buy German forged steel bracket and machine posts flat and perpendicular -ready for fitting Sexy workmanship - caliper now repainted too!
.jpg)
Assemble bells onto the Audi TT 312mm Discs that you have parted off and had grooved, star design pat pend! Zinc coat disc for extra bling
.jpg)
Assemble final time and remachine if neccessary
.jpg)
Bolt on and laugh your little ass off... i love working in a metal fab shop!
What does everyone think - sexy? 312mm under a standard 16" cupra rim - anyone beat that?? It has been a bit of a mission it took about a month of evenings and mornings around work but i think it has been worthwhile, i fully bled the system with braided lines at the weekend and they seem incredible! i think i have managed to do the whole thing for sub £550 - i think i have saved a lot of cash??
